Misty throws a stone horizontally from the roof edge of a 50. meter high dormitory. It hits the ground at a point 60. m from the building.
 
  (a) Determine the horizontal component of velocity just before hitting the ground.
  (b) What vertical speed did it have just before hitting the ground?

Glaucoma is a leading cause of blindness. As of yet, there is no cure. Everyone is at risk, and there may be no warning signs. It is six to eight times more common in African Americans than in whites. The best and most effective way to detect glaucoma is to receive a dilated eye examination.
